The Certified Drone Warfare and Autonomous Defense Professional (CDWADP) program provides a comprehensive understanding of modern drone warfare, autonomous defense systems, AI-enabled military operations, and the strategic implications of unmanned technologies.

Participants learn how unmanned aerial, ground, maritime, and underwater systems are transforming warfare while examining autonomous targeting, counter-drone operations, swarming technologies, and ethical considerations.

This certification combines operational, technical, strategic, and policy perspectives to prepare defense professionals for future autonomous battlefields.
